Our City Forest is a San Jose based 501C3 nonprofit organization whose mission is to cultivate a green and healthy Silicon Valley by engaging community members in the appreciation, protection, growth and maintenance of our urban ecosystem, especially our urban forest. In the past few years, we have received commendation with the ISA Gold Lead Award, the CA Urban Forestry Council Award, and the Silicon Valley Water Conservation Award. Our City Forest was one of two organizations in the nation to win the 2015 Senator Harkin Award for Community Service. Through Our City Forest, 160,000 volunteers have assisted at thousands of plantings, tree care, and community education projects, positively impacting local neighborhoods and the urban ecosystem. Our valued volunteers participate in weekly tree plantings, community nursery projects, outreach, and educational presentations. Since 1994, Our City Forest’s passionate AmeriCorps teams, together with dedicated community volunteers, have planted upwards of 100,000 free or subsidized 15-gallon shade trees in San José area neighborhood streets, yards, schools, parks, and public facilities. Our City Forest's stewardship training and tracking program has achieved a 93%+ survival rate as a result of the hard work of dedicated volunteers working closely with Our City Forest personnel. Our City Forest strives to increase public awareness of the benefits and needs of a healthy urban ecosystem with our community outreach efforts, educational programs, and volunteerism.
